Intermittent nearside low beam

Post by DaveH38 »

i have had a 2005 xc70 from new and its been a fantastic car , but recently I have been getting a warning message of " dip beam bulb failure ". The bulb was found to be ok so I cleaned all the contacts and refitted it . This seemed to cure the fault - for a while - then it happened again . It appears to be when I switch the ignition on , sometimes the warning message comes on and sometimes its ok so I am now leaning toward the relay which I understand controls the nearside low beam . Has anyone had similar problems , if so how do I find the relay and where do I obtain a relacement . Dave
